7mm-08 you can't go wrong. If you think she can take a little more recoil then I would move towards 25-06 for longer distance shooting. The 7-08 would be my first choice for a lady or child because of the short action, shorter easier to handle gun and manageable recoil with plenty of knockdown downrange.

Depends on her build. Height? Long arms or short? Will it be just for TX game, or will you also chase larger exotics? Do you reload?
If you don't reload, my top choices would be .25-06 or 7mm-08. My wife is 5' 7", she loves her .25-06. She can practice with it without being scared. But, if you think critters larger than deer/pigs are in her future, I might drift towards the 7mm-08.
Whatever you do, make sure the rifle comes with a good recoil pad, or better yet, take it to a gun smith and have him add a good pad and fit the stock to her length-of-pull.
The .260 Rem is a great little round and would be my top choice, but it is not widely available in many rifles and ammo is tougher to find.
